A powerful explosion rocked Nalagarh town in Himachal Pradesh on New Year morning, triggering panic among residents. The blast occurred around 9:45 am near the Nalagarh police station in Solan district.
The explosion was so intense that people heard it several kilometres away. Windows of nearby buildings shattered due to the impact. Damaged structures included the police station, Sainik Bhawan, and the Market Committee office.
Residents rushed out of their homes in fear after hearing the loud sound. Police received the alert and immediately swung into action. Baddi Superintendent of Police Vinod Dhiman reached the spot along with senior officers.
Authorities sealed the area and evacuated nearby buildings as a precautionary measure. A forensic team arrived at the scene and began collecting samples. Investigators are examining debris to determine the exact cause of the blast.
Police officials have not confirmed whether the explosion resulted from an explosive device, gas leakage, or technical fault. They said it would be premature to draw conclusions before forensic analysis.
The incident took place during peak tourist season, as thousands of visitors arrived in Himachal Pradesh to celebrate the New Year. Officials confirmed that no casualties or injuries have been reported so far.
